Market Overview
Lexington is a small resort village on Michigan’s Lake Huron shoreline in Sanilac County, approximately one hour north of Detroit on M-25. The STR market had 1,948 active listings as of April 2026. The market posted an average daily rate of $161 and occupancy of 42.3% in April 2026, generating average monthly revenue of $1,588 per listing. RevPAR was $68. April is a seasonally soft month for this heavily summer-oriented market.
Listing composition is predominantly entire-place rentals: 1,893 of 1,948 listings (97.2%) are entire-place units and 55 are private-room. Bedroom distribution: 373 one-bedroom, 691 two-bedroom, 570 three-bedroom, 186 four-bedroom, and 128 five-plus-bedroom units. Two-bedroom and three-bedroom properties make up the largest share. Platform distribution: 853 listings appear on both Airbnb and VRBO, 786 are Airbnb-only, and 309 are VRBO-only.
Year-over-year from April 2025, occupancy declined 8.3% while ADR rose 5.9%, resulting in a net revenue decline of 11.0%. The market continues a post-pandemic demand rebalancing from its 2020-2021 peak occupancy levels.

Seasonal Patterns
| Month | Occupancy |
|---|---|
| Jan | 36% |
| Feb | 42% |
| Mar | 43% |
| Apr | 44% |
| May | 49% |
| Jun | 61% |
| Jul | 74% |
| Aug | 67% |
| Sep | 41% |
| Oct | 39% |
| Nov | 39% |
| Dec | 40% |

Short-Term Rental Regulations
Short-term rentals are legal in the Village of Lexington under a registration program. Michigan sets no STR regulations at the state level beyond requiring collection of the 6% state use tax on stays under 30 days. Local rules are set by the village.
Lexington’s Zoning Ordinance, Section 5.25 (Short-Term Residential Rentals in Residential Districts, last revised August 2025), defines an STR as renting a dwelling or portion of a dwelling for compensation for fewer than 30 days. Owners must complete an application, follow a Good Neighbor Guide, and renew periodically (renewal appears to be annual based on village forms, though the exact renewal period and application fee were not confirmed in publicly available documents). The program applies to rentals in residential neighborhoods; no owner-occupancy or primary-residence requirement was found in the available ordinance materials.
Guests pay a 6% Michigan accommodations tax on stays under 30 days. Sanilac County does not appear to levy an additional county lodging excise tax. Enforcement is rated moderate.
Investors should confirm current application fees, district-specific restrictions, parking requirements, and occupancy limits directly with the Village of Lexington Zoning Administrator before purchasing, as the August 2025 ordinance revision may have updated specific thresholds not confirmed from public documents.
Market Comparison
Nationally, STR markets average approximately 55% occupancy and $220 in ADR. Lexington’s April 2026 metrics of 42.3% occupancy and $161 ADR fall below both national benchmarks, consistent with April being a pre-season month for this summer-concentrated market. The 2025 annual average occupancy of 49.2% and ADR of $200 are more representative comparisons against national norms.

The market’s investability score of 99.0 out of 100 distinguishes Lexington from most comparable lake markets. Lower entry price points relative to revenue potential create a favorable yield profile. The trade-off is the pronounced summer concentration, which requires reserves to cover nine months of below-average revenue.
